Teen Photo Camp - Seattle, WA
Teens Camp (ages 13-18) If your teen is looking for a fun way to spend their summer, this is it! Students wil learn beginner photography with Mirroless cameras that wil be provided to them. Creative techniques will also be introduced to help enhance their skills and imaginations! Students are required to bring their own SD card to each class. Class Schedule: 10-10:30- In class demo 10:30-11- walk to location 11-12:30- shooting on location 12:30-1- lunch 1- 1:30- walk back to classroom 1:30- 2- Printing best shots of the day Monday: Students will be introduced to their cameras and photography basics. After the presentation we will walk to the Space needle to work on composition assignments. Back in class students will print their 3 best shots of the day. Tuesday: Today we will be going over aperture priority and depth of field. Class will head over to Lake Union. On the way back to class we will introduce bokeh and students will have the chance to try changing the shape of their bokeh in South Lake Union. Back in class students will print their 3 best shots of the day. Wednesday: Our first introduction to shutter speeds will include an in class demo for stopping action. Minecraft Makers (Session 2) - Northwest Art Center
Age Range: 7 and up Description: Campers will spend a week exploring all things Minecraft: from educational MODs, build challenges, hands on clay Minecraft figurine building, build a Minecraft torch that lights up, hour of code with Minecraft, Minecraft style block art tile painting, learn about screen printing and stencil your very own Creeper t-shirt, make Minecraft Creepers out of Hama beads, to paper arts and more. Students will spend about half the session online playing in a safe Minecraft student education environment, the other half creating Minecraft themed art.
